- Costco Website and App: Start by checking the official Costco website or app. Use the store locator to find Costco warehouses in your general area. Once you've identified potential locations, call them directly. Ask if they have a furniture outlet section or if they carry clearance furniture items. Sometimes, the website might list "Costco Business Centers" which often have a larger selection of furniture.
- Google Maps is Your Friend: Search on Google Maps for "Costco furniture" or "Costco liquidation." Sometimes, these searches will reveal locations that are known to carry outlet furniture. Be sure to read the reviews, as other shoppers often share their experiences and provide valuable information.
- Online Forums and Groups: Online forums and social media groups dedicated to Costco enthusiasts can be goldmines of information. Check out sites like Reddit's r/Costco or Facebook groups dedicated to Costco deals. Members often share tips and locations of Costco furniture outlets they've stumbled upon.
- Word of Mouth: Don't underestimate the power of word of mouth! Ask your friends, family, and neighbors if they know of any Costco locations with a good furniture selection or outlet section. You might be surprised at what you discover.
- Call Your Local Costco Warehouses Directly: This is perhaps the most reliable method. Call the Costco warehouses in your area and ask if they have a furniture outlet section or carry clearance furniture. Be specific in your questions to get the most accurate information.
- Go Early and Often: The best deals tend to go quickly, so try to visit the outlet as soon as it opens. Also, frequent visits increase your chances of finding something you love. Inventory changes rapidly, so what's not there today might be there tomorrow.
- Be Flexible: Don't go in with a rigid idea of what you want. Be open to different styles and colors. You might stumble upon a hidden gem that you never would have considered otherwise.
- Inspect Carefully: As mentioned earlier, thoroughly inspect the furniture for any damages or imperfections before making a purchase. Check for scratches, dents, stains, and any other flaws. Remember, outlet items are typically sold as-is, so you won't be able to return them simply because you don't like the condition.
- Know Your Prices: Before you go, do some research on the regular retail prices of similar furniture items. This will give you a better sense of whether you're truly getting a good deal at the outlet.
- Measure Your Space: Bring a tape measure and know the dimensions of the space you're furnishing. This will prevent you from buying furniture that's too big or too small for your room.
- Bring Help: Furniture can be heavy and bulky, so bring a friend or family member to help you load and unload it. You'll also need help inspecting the furniture for damages.
- Consider Transportation: Think about how you're going to transport the furniture home. Bring a large vehicle or be prepared to rent a truck. Also, bring some moving blankets and straps to protect the furniture during transport.
- Don't Be Afraid to Negotiate: While Costco doesn't typically negotiate prices, it doesn't hurt to ask if there's any wiggle room, especially if you find a minor imperfection. The worst they can say is no.
- Be Patient: Finding the perfect piece of furniture at a Costco outlet can take time and effort. Don't get discouraged if you don't find anything on your first visit. Keep checking back, and eventually, you'll strike gold!

What is a Costco Furniture Outlet?
So, what exactly is a Costco furniture outlet? Think of it as a treasure trove of discounted furniture. These outlets are essentially warehouses where Costco clears out overstocked items, discontinued models, and returned furniture. This means you can score some seriously high-quality pieces at a fraction of the original price.
The furniture available at these outlets can range from sofas and sectionals to dining sets, bedroom furniture, mattresses, and even outdoor patio sets. The selection varies from store to store and changes frequently, which is part of the thrill of the hunt. You never know what amazing deal you might find! Because the items are often clearance or returned goods, they are typically offered at significant discounts compared to regular Costco prices or other furniture retailers. This is a fantastic opportunity for Costco members to furnish their homes with stylish, well-made pieces while saving a considerable amount of money.
Keep in mind that while the savings are substantial, the availability of specific items can be unpredictable. It’s not uncommon for popular items to sell out quickly, and the stock is constantly being updated with new arrivals. This means that frequent visits to your local Costco furniture outlet can increase your chances of finding the perfect piece for your home. Additionally, it’s wise to inspect items carefully for any minor damages or imperfections, as these items are typically sold as-is. Don’t hesitate to ask store associates about the history of a particular piece or any warranty information that may be available.

What to Expect When You Get There
Okay, so you've found a Costco furniture outlet – woohoo! But before you rush in with visions of a perfectly furnished home, let's talk about what to expect. Knowing what you're getting into will make your shopping trip way smoother and more successful.
First off, be prepared for a no-frills shopping experience. Unlike traditional furniture stores with their carefully curated displays and attentive salespeople, Costco furniture outlets are more like warehouses. The furniture is often displayed in a straightforward, functional manner. Don't expect elaborate staging or personalized design advice. The focus here is on value and selection.
The selection can be hit or miss, which is part of the adventure! You might find exactly what you're looking for on one visit, and on another, you might come up empty-handed. Inventory changes rapidly, so it pays to visit often and be ready to act fast when you spot something you love. Keep in mind that the furniture available at outlets often includes discontinued items, overstock, or returned merchandise. This is why the prices are so attractive, but it also means that availability can be unpredictable.
Before making a purchase, thoroughly inspect the furniture for any damages or imperfections. While most items are in good condition, it's always wise to check for scratches, dents, or other flaws. Keep in mind that outlet items are typically sold as-is, so you won't be able to return them simply because you changed your mind. However, Costco's generous return policy usually applies to defects or significant issues with the furniture.
Be prepared to transport the furniture yourself. Costco furniture outlets typically don't offer delivery services for outlet items. Bring a large vehicle or be ready to rent a truck to haul your new finds home. It's also a good idea to bring some moving blankets and straps to protect the furniture during transport.
Finally, remember that the prices at Costco furniture outlets are often unbeatable. You can save a significant amount of money compared to buying new furniture at regular retail stores. However, be sure to factor in the cost of transportation and any potential repairs or cleaning that may be needed.
